Making Conscious Choices: From Floorboards to Framework


When it involves choosing products, the variety of eco-conscious choices has actually never been a lot more abundant. Redeemed wood, for example, offers a cozy, rustic charm while giving new life to formerly used products. Bamboo is another preferred choice for floor covering-- fast-growing and highly sustainable, it brings a modern-day look with a considerably reduced ecological cost. For insulation, natural alternatives like sheep's wool or cellulose give outstanding thermal security without harmful chemicals. Also paints and adhesives currently come in low-VOC or zero-VOC formulas, lowering harmful discharges inside the home.

Bringing the Outdoors In with Sustainable Decking Options


Exterior spaces are just as vital when thinking about an environment-friendly approach. Decks, patios, and gardens all provide chances to merge comfort with conservation. Conventional decking materials, such as neglected timber, might include high maintenance requirements and shorter lifespans. Thankfully, there are better alternatives today. Composite outdoor decking, made from a mix of recycled wood and plastics, has actually acquired popularity for its lasting resilience and reduced ecological influence. It simulates the look of timber without the demand for severe sealants or constant fixings.

Small Changes, Big Results: Everyday Sustainability at Home


Even if you're not taking on a full-scale remodelling, small updates can still make a big difference. Swapping out old light bulbs for LEDs, installing a smart hot water heater, or changing single-pane home windows with protected ones can dramatically minimize a home's power use. Sustainable living does not need to be overwhelming-- it's typically the build-up of thoughtful choices that leads to lasting adjustment.


And it's not almost the preliminary installation. Upkeep plays a significant role in expanding the life of your home and the products you've chosen. Securing fractures, checking water use, and keeping HVAC systems tidy are ongoing behaviors that protect efficiency and shield your financial investment.
